Discover the profound insights of Ecological Crisis and Cultural Representation in Latin America by Mark Anderson, published by Bloomsbury Publishing Plc in 2016. This thought-provoking hardback spans 362 pages and delves into the intricate portrayals of environmental crises across Latin American literature, film, performance, and digital art. Anderson adopts an ecocritical lens to explore these representations against the backdrop of the relentless expansion of globalized neoliberal capitalism.
